To find the difference between the two numbers we will do:
7°C - (-5°C)
Subtracting a negative number is the same as simply adding, so we can rewrite the equation as:
7°C + 5°C = 12°C

Given: In triangle ABC, a=9, c=5 and ∠B=120°.
To find: The value of
.
solution: It is given that In triangle ABC, a=9, c=5 and ∠B=120°.
Now, using the law of cosines, we get
![b^2=a^2+c^2-2(a)(c)cosB](https://tex.z-dn.net/?f=b%5E2%3Da%5E2%2Bc%5E2-2%28a%29%28c%29cosB)
Substituting the given values, we get
![b^2=9^2+5^2-2(9)(5)cosB](https://tex.z-dn.net/?f=b%5E2%3D9%5E2%2B5%5E2-2%289%29%285%29cosB)
![b^2=81+25-90(\frac{-1}{2})](https://tex.z-dn.net/?f=b%5E2%3D81%2B25-90%28%5Cfrac%7B-1%7D%7B2%7D%29)
![b^2=81+25+45](https://tex.z-dn.net/?f=b%5E2%3D81%2B25%2B45)
![b^2=151](https://tex.z-dn.net/?f=b%5E2%3D151)
which is the required value of
.
Therefore, option D is correct.
